Output d894999537736b975a9fa62462e5d5d406d5a0d5bbdf6ae0d02df5987fe6baae:2

value
65088492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da18a2ce58484986489184b3cb6d466d5b036fb3 OP_EQUAL
address
3MaCk6iXpBr25XejNFdUCVetd3KZtjJKs9
transaction
d894999537736b975a9fa62462e5d5d406d5a0d5bbdf6ae0d02df5987fe6baae
spent
true